package org.apache.tuscany.sca.host.http;
import java.io.IOException;
import java.net.URL;
import java.util.ArrayList;
import java.util.Collection;
import java.util.List;
import javax.servlet.RequestDispatcher;
import javax.servlet.Servlet;
import javax.servlet.ServletContext;
import org.apache.tuscany.sca.core.ExtensionPointRegistry;
import org.apache.tuscany.sca.core.LifeCycleListener;
import org.apache.tuscany.sca.extensibility.ServiceDeclaration;
import org.apache.tuscany.sca.extensibility.ServiceHelper;
/**
* Default implementation of a Servlet host extension point.
*
* @version $Rev$ $Date$
*/
public class DefaultServletHostExtensionPoint implements ServletHostExtensionPoint, LifeCycleListener {
private List<ServletHost> servletHosts = new ArrayList<ServletHost>();
private boolean loaded;
private boolean webApp;
private ExtensionPointRegistry registry;
public DefaultServletHostExtensionPoint(ExtensionPointRegistry registry) {
this.registry = registry;
}
public void addServletHost(ServletHost servletHost) {
servletHosts.add(servletHost);
if (servletHost instanceof LifeCycleListener) {
((LifeCycleListener)servletHost).start();
}
}
public void removeServletHost(ServletHost servletHost) {
servletHosts.remove(servletHost);
if (servletHost instanceof LifeCycleListener) {
((LifeCycleListener)servletHost).stop();
}
}
public List<ServletHost> getServletHosts() {
loadServletHosts();
return servletHosts;
}
private synchronized void loadServletHosts() {
if (loaded)
return;
// Get the databinding service declarations
Collection<ServiceDeclaration> sds;
try {
sds = registry.getServiceDiscovery().getServiceDeclarations(ServletHost.class, true);
} catch (IOException e) {
throw new IllegalStateException(e);
}
// Load data bindings
for (ServiceDeclaration sd : sds) {
// Create a data binding wrapper and register it
ServletHost servletHost = new LazyServletHost(sd);
addServletHost(servletHost);
}
loaded = true;
}
/**
* A data binding facade allowing data bindings to be lazily loaded and
* initialized.
*/
public class LazyServletHost implements ServletHost, LifeCycleListener {
private ServiceDeclaration sd;
private ServletHost host;
/**
* @param sd
*/
public LazyServletHost(ServiceDeclaration sd) {
super();
this.sd = sd;
}
public synchronized ServletHost getServletHost() {
if (host == null) {
try {
host = ServiceHelper.newInstance(registry, sd);
ServiceHelper.start(host);
} catch (Throwable e) {
throw new IllegalStateException(e);
}
}
return host;
}
public String addServletMapping(String uri, Servlet servlet) throws ServletMappingException {
return getServletHost().addServletMapping(uri, servlet);
}
public String addServletMapping(String uri, Servlet servlet, SecurityContext securityContext) throws ServletMappingException {
return getServletHost().addServletMapping(uri, servlet, securityContext);
}
public String getContextPath() {
return getServletHost().getContextPath();
}
public int getDefaultPort() {
return getServletHost().getDefaultPort();
}
public RequestDispatcher getRequestDispatcher(String uri) throws ServletMappingException {
return getServletHost().getRequestDispatcher(uri);
}
public Servlet getServletMapping(String uri) throws ServletMappingException {
return getServletHost().getServletMapping(uri);
}
public URL getURLMapping(String uri, SecurityContext securityContext) {
return getServletHost().getURLMapping(uri, securityContext);
}
public Servlet removeServletMapping(String uri) throws ServletMappingException {
return getServletHost().removeServletMapping(uri);
}
public void setAttribute(String name, Object value) {
getServletHost().setAttribute(name, value);
}
public void setContextPath(String path) {
getServletHost().setContextPath(path);
}
public void setDefaultPort(int port) {
getServletHost().setDefaultPort(port);
}
public String getName() {
return sd.getAttributes().get("name");
}
public void start() {
}
public void stop() {
ServiceHelper.stop(host);
}
@Override
public ServletContext getServletContext() {
return getServletHost().getServletContext();
}
}
public void start() {
}
public void stop() {
ServiceHelper.stop(servletHosts);
servletHosts.clear();
registry = null;
}
public boolean isWebApp() {
return webApp;
}
public void setWebApp(boolean webApp) {
this.webApp = webApp;
}
}
